Occupation profile

Provide barbering services, such as cutting, trimming, shampooing, and styling hair; trimming beards; or giving shaves.

Demand outlook

Overall employment of barbers, hairstylists, and cosmetologists is projected to grow 5 percent from 2024 to 2034, faster than the average for all occupations.

Education: Postsecondary nondegree award Experience: None

Tasks

  • 1. Clean and sterilize scissors, combs, clippers, and other instruments. AI use: 0%
  • 2. Cut and trim hair according to clients' instructions or current hairstyles, using clippers, combs, hand-held blow driers, and scissors. AI use: 0%
  • 3. Drape and pin protective cloths around customers' shoulders. AI use: 0%
  • 4. Clean work stations and sweep floors. AI use: 0%
  • 5. Question patrons regarding desired services and haircut styles. AI use: 0%
  • 6. Shape and trim beards and moustaches, using scissors. AI use: 0%
